>

【云顶娱乐yd2221】依傍OSO的论坛_php底子_脚本之家

- 编辑:云顶娱乐yd2221 -

【云顶娱乐yd2221】依傍OSO的论坛_php底子_脚本之家

//树型目录布局模板程序//菜单目录库字段表达://menu_id 菜单连串 id//menu 菜单名称//menu_grade 菜单等第 1 为主菜单 2 为二级菜单 ........//menu_superior 上超级菜单 id 号function my_menu($menu_content,$i,$menu_grade_temp,$menu_superior_temp){global $PHP_SELF;$temp1=$menu_grade_temp+1;$menu_superior_temp_array=split("/",$menu_superior_temp);for {$menu_array=split("/",$menu_content[$t]);If(($menu_【云顶娱乐yd2221】依傍OSO的论坛_php底子_脚本之家,基于mysql的论坛_php基本功_脚本之家。array[2]==$menu_grade_temp)&&($menu_array[3]==$menu_superior_temp_array[$menu_grade_temp-1])){for($p=1;$p<=$menu_grade_temp;$p++){echo "";}$temp3=$menu_superior_temp_array;$temp3[$menu_grade_temp]=$menu_array[0];$temp2=implode;if ($menu_array[0]==$menu_superior_temp_array[$temp1-1]){$temp5=$temp1-1;$temp3[$menu_grade_temp]="";$temp6=implode;echo "$menu_array[1]
";my_menu($menu_content,$i,$temp1,$temp2);}else{$temp3[$menu_grade_temp+1]="";$temp6=implode;echo "$menu_array[1]
";}}}}// 连接 MySql 数据库$db_host="localhost";$db_user="dkj";$db_password="123";$db_name="test";mysql_connect($db_host,$db_user,$db_password);mysql_select_db;//从数据库中获得数据$query_string="select * from menu order by menu_grade";$db_data=mysql_query;//第一回施行初阶化if ($menu_grade_temp==""){$menu_superior_temp=0;}//将全体的信息读入数组,并总结数组个数$i=0;while (list($menu_id,$menu,$menu_grade,$menu_superior)=mysql_fetch_row{$menu_content[$i]=$menu_id."/".$menu."/".$menu_grade."/".$menu_superior;$i++;}my_menu($menu_content,$i,1,$menu_superior_temp);/* 附数据库布局及模拟数据# phpMyAdmin MySQL-Dump## 主机: localhost 数据库 : test# --------------------------------------------------------## 数据表的布局 'menu'#CREATE TABLE menu NOT NULL auto_increment,menu varchar NOT NULL,menu_grade int NOT NULL,menu_superior int NOT NULL,UNIQUE menu_id ;## 导出下边包车型地铁数据库内容 'menu'#INSERT INTO menu VALUES( '1', '计算机', '1', '0'卡塔尔(قطر‎;INSERT INTO menu VALUES;INSERT INTO menu VALUES;INSERT INTO menu VALUES( '4', 'PHP与MySql', '3', '2'卡塔尔;INSERT INTO menu VALUES( '5', 'C语言', '3', '2'State of Qatar;INSERT INTO menu VALUES( '6', '网页制作', '3', '3'卡塔尔(قطر‎;INSERT INTO menu VALUES( '7', 'TCP、IP公约', '3', '3'卡塔尔(قطر‎;INSERT INTO menu VALUES;INSERT INTO menu VALUES( '9', '高档数学', '2', '8'卡塔尔国;INSERT INTO menu VALUES( '10', '线性代数', '3', '9'State of Qatar;INSERT INTO menu VALUES( '11', '离散数学', '3', '9'卡塔尔;INSERT INTO menu VALUES( '12', '初等数学', '2', '8'卡塔尔(قطر‎;INSERT INTO menu VALUES( '13', '教育学', '1', '0'卡塔尔(قطر‎;INSERT INTO menu VALUES( '14', '中夏族民共和国文学', '2', '13'卡塔尔国;INSERT INTO menu VALUES( '15', 'php', '4', '4'State of Qatar;INSERT INTO menu VALUES( '16', 'mysql', '4', '4'卡塔尔国;*/?>

那篇随笔的目标是报告你在Win2004Professional下何以将PHP4配置到您的IIS第55中学。笔者用的是Windows2002Professional罗马尼亚语版、IIS5匈牙利语版和PHP4.0.4-Win32 Binaries,能够从PHP的官方站点www.php.net下载。注意别下载错了,那么些PHP4.0.4 Release Candidate 1 Source是为Unix客商计划的,你供给的是PHP 4.0.4 Release Candidate1 Binaries for Win32。 注意,首先你要安装IIS5,因为Win二〇〇三Professional暗中认可安装时把它给忘了。IIS5的装置格局在此边就毫无商讨了吧,如果有标题请参考其余资料。 OK! 第一步,解开PHP4.0.4-Win32.ZIP压缩包,你能够把它放在C:PHP4上边。 第二步,把C:PHP4上边包车型地铁php.ini-dist文件复制到WINNT目录下,并改名成php.ini。你无需改良任何参数就足以运作,当然依照不相同情状你能够自行更正某些参数。 第三步,把C:PHP4php4ts.dll复制到C:WINNTsystem32目录下。 第四步,点start->programs->adminstrative tools->internet service manager 第五步,在Computer管理窗口上开展“服务和应用程序”/“Internet新闻服务”,在“暗许Web站点”上点鼠标右键,选属性,此时系统弹出“暗中认可Web站点属性”窗口 第六步,在“默许Web站点属性”窗口上点取“ISAPI筛选器”标签,点击“增多”开关,在弹出的“筛选器属性”窗口的“筛选器名称”中输入“PHP”,“可施行文件”中输入“C:PHP4sapiphp4isapi.dll”,明确。 第七步,在“私下认可Web站点属性”窗口上点取“主目录”标签,点“配置”开关,在弹出的“应用程序配置”窗口中式茶食取“加多”开关,在弹出的“增加/编辑应用程序扩大名影象”对话框中的“可试行文件”文本框中输入“C:PHP4sapiphp4isapi.dll”,“扩张名”文本框中输入“.php”,分明。 第八步,回到命令行窗口,输入“net stop iisadmin”命令,终止IIS服务。系统会问您是或不是要将有关的劳动也停下,答是。 重新起动IIS服务。 OK,你的布署到此已经收尾了,下面让我们写一个PHP程序,试验须臾间安顿是还是不是中标!编辑二个文书,名叫hello.php,内容为: 把那些文件保留在暗中同意Web节点的暗许文文件目录下,然后张开浏览器,在地方栏中输入localhost/hello.php,如若顺利,卓绝的“Hello,World!”应该出今后您的浏览器中。要是找不到页面,而你也能认同上述几步都没难点,那么在浏览器的位置栏中输入地点127.0.0.1/hello.php试试看,要是能学有所成,则印证您的hosts文件非凡,请编辑C:WINNTsystem32driversetc上边包车型地铁hosts文件,参加“127.0.0.1 localhost”风度翩翩行。 好啊,开头你的PHP之旅吧!

在前头的post.php及reply.php中,在解说提交成功后都跳转到一个叫post_end.php的页面,这些页面主假设提示发言提交成功,并付诸了叁个到faq.php的链接,程序特别轻易,小编就生机勃勃并写在底下了: 你的发言已提交
回到疑难难点首页 在此焕发青新年中,大家将全力以赴钻探假如完成我们在初始所列出的本论坛所缺乏的八项意义: 1、在自小编的论坛中独有在顾客登陆后技艺发言,客商的ID是存在一个叫“cookie_user”的cookie变量中的。 作者想那应该不是论坛程序的首要内容,关于客户登入,有许多很周密的顺序可供参照他事他说加以考查,要是您想让您的论坛程序更宏观的话,你能够虚构在post.php及reply.php中增多叁个客户登陆的模块。你还是可以在假造在客商率先次登陆时,自动帮他做客户注册。 2、笔者的论坛未有子论坛。 事实上,那不得不在数据表guestbook中加多二个字段id_style,以注解所属子论坛的id,此外你最佳规划三个数据表,名字叫bm_style,该表包蕴三个字段:style_code,style_name,而在guestbook中的字段id_style应该存放的是子论坛编码。 3、作者一贯不统计三个主旨的点击数。 在数量表guestbook中增加二个字段count_read,在post.php将其带头值设为1,在read.php中校其丰硕。 4、在OSO论坛中每一个主旨后面包车型大巴象征有未有新贴子的Logo笔者也没安插。 在用户的cookie中著录顾客最终一遍阅读贴子的日子,然后用这一个时刻与time_close举行相比,假设time_close大于那么些值,就将该核心标志为有新贴子。 5、对于OSO论坛所提供的可采纳的核心排列格局以致显示时间段笔者也没思谋。 给客商一个取舍的下拉列表框,并基于顾客筛选的排列格局退换read.php中select语句order子句的剧情,依据客商选用的展现时间段扩充where子句。 6、没有会员发贴积分的总结。 在my_user表中追加point字段,注册时置一个初叶值,在post.php及reply.php中扩展对应积分。 7、未有版主管理论坛的效劳。 在my_user表中加进type字段,注解顾客类型,对于项目为版主的客户能够步向贰个拘系分界面,能够对guestbook数据表实行delete操作。 8、没有贴子编辑的效能。 对于客户本身的贴子(即guestbook中的name和cookie中的name相符State of Qatar,能够让客商对其实践相应update操作。 至此,那篇习作全体终了,有不到之处,还请各位高手商议指正,在这之中涉及有抄袭OSO思疑的,在这里生机勃勃并向各位OSO的老同志致谢。 【本文版权归小编与奥索网协同具备,如需转发,请注脚笔者及出处】

#################################云顶娱乐yd2221 , ## apply.php #################### #################################

############################################### 此篇小说属原创,如有援引,请标记笔者音信。 小编:冷情疯子 Email: edincur@yeah.net ############################################### ## adduser.php ################################ ############################################### 16 or strlen>16 or strlen{ show_error; $founderr=1; } $password=$pwd1; if { adduser(); echo "成功!"; } ?> ###################### ### admin.php ######## ######################

登记顾客

管理

本文由云顶娱乐yd2221发布,转载请注明来源:【云顶娱乐yd2221】依傍OSO的论坛_php底子_脚本之家